The Metal machining offers exceptional accuracy and capabilities for a wide array of applications. This process leverages advanced computer controls to guide cutting tools, enabling the creation of complex geometries with remarkable consistency. The inherent qualities of aluminium alloy, including its excellent machinability and strength-to-weight ratio, make it an ideal material for this type of fabrication. Manufacturers often choose computer numerical control processes to website produce items demanding tight tolerances and high surface finishes in industries like aerospace, automotive, and electronics, guaranteeing both structural integrity and a visually appealing look.

Cutting-Edge Techniques in Aluminium Computer Numerical Control Milling & Profiling

To obtain optimal surface finish and tight tolerances when working with Al in CNC milling and profiling, sophisticated techniques are critical . This goes beyond basic programming; it encompasses a variety of strategies. To begin, toolpath optimization is vital, employing methods like adaptive milling to reduce cutting forces and improve material removal rates, which is particularly important when dealing with the natural work hardening characteristics of aluminum. Furthermore, consideration of coolant delivery—whether utilizing high-pressure through-tool systems or specialized mist applications – is crucial for effective chip evacuation and temperature control. Selecting appropriate tooling geometries, including end mills with varying flute designs and coatings specifically formulated for aluminum alloys, allows for efficient cutting. Lastly , utilizing process monitoring systems that track factors such as spindle load and vibration can provide valuable feedback for live adjustments, enhancing both part quality and machine longevity.

  • Employing high speed machining (HSM).
  • Optimizing toolpaths using CAM software.
  • Selecting the right cutting fluids.
